By Pictolic https://pictolic.com/article/houses-whose-architects-refused-to-cut-down-trees.htmlYou can either fight with nature or interact with it. The architects of these houses chose the second: the trees are not cut down, but are embedded in the design of buildings. Urbanization is an important factor in so-called deforestation, or deforestation.
Why don't we try to fit houses into the environment as neatly as possible?
